Sweet Potato Greens

Published by Mike on July 26, 2018

It’s hot outside and not many greens growing during this hot Georgia heat!  No fear-sweet potatoes are tropical plants and love the heat.  Sweet potato greens have been eaten in many cultures but here in Georgia we think about that yummy sweet potato that will be coming later but we don’t think about how delicious the greens can be!  Give them a try and you will be a believer!

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

Ingredients:

Bundle of sweet potato greens  (I like them with some of the stems still attached-gives a little more crunch)

3-4 cloves garlic

onion (I like a red onion for the flavor and for the color that it gives the dish)

Oil of your choice  (I like either bacon grease or ghee but any healthy oil can be used)

Bacon  (Not for everybody but we love it)

 

How to Make It

If you are using bacon go ahead and fry it till crispy.  Remove the bacon from the pan but leave enough oil to cover the bottom of the pan.

If you don’t use bacon add your oil of choice.

Add your minced garlic and chopped onions to the medium hot pan.

Cook these until the onions are starting to soften.  Be careful not to burn the garlic.

Add the washed and chopped sweet potato greens.  If you are adding the stems you may want to add them a minute or two earlier than the leaves to let them soften a bit.

Toss the greens with the onions and garlic till they turn a bright green and are tender to your taste.

This is a quick dish-not taking a long time to cook.

If you like, add the crumbled bacon over the top of your greens.
